The solution for NYT Wordle #1529 is ANNEX.
According to Merriam-Webster Dictionary, the word ‘Annex’ comes from the Latin word annexus, meaning ‘to tie to.’ In history, it’s used to describe the secret hiding places behind the bookcase where the famous writer Anne Frank and others stayed in Amsterdam during World War II. In modern usage, it often refers to a building or space added to a main structure, or even the act of one country adding another territory.
